Chapter 63: Chapter 33: Sister-in-law, Looking Forward to Meeting You Tonight

"What did you say? A new wedding?"

While eating breakfast, Jiang Li made a video call to Jing Shiyun.

They exchanged a few pleasantries first, and once the atmosphere was fairly congenial, she relayed Shen Yanzhi’s idea from yesterday to Jing Shiyun.

Jiang Li nodded emphatically, trying to persuade her. "Wasn’t our wedding too rushed back then? Ah Yan’s friends and family didn’t even come. Besides, that wedding was originally for me and Zhao Sinian. For the sake of harmony in my marriage with Ah Yan, we really need to have another ceremony."

Jing Shiyun thought about it and realized it was true. ’A last-minute groom swap, and even the wedding photos were Photoshopped. Shen Yanzhi must feel a little uncomfortable about it all.’

She tried to see it from his perspective; if it had been Jiang Li in that situation, her daughter would have certainly wanted a proper wedding of her own.

"Having another ceremony is fine, but our family and friends won’t be giving gifts again."

’Accepting gifts a second time would be a bit unreasonable.’

Jiang Li chuckled. "That’s what I was thinking, too. We’ll just invite them for a meal."

Jing Shiyun shook her head with a resigned sigh. "Alright. In that case, you and Xiao Shen should pick a time for our two families to meet and discuss the wedding arrangements."

’Even though she had the Shen Family’s contact information, this was a wedding they were planning. They should at least sit down and discuss it face to face.’

’Besides, since Jiang Li was telling her this, the Shen Family’s parents were presumably already aware of the plan.’

Seeing that Jing Shiyun agreed, Jiang Li rubbed the tip of her nose. "Ah Yan’s idea is to have it at our home tomorrow evening. He’ll cook, and both sets of parents can have a good talk about the wedding."

This was what she and Shen Yanzhi had discussed last night. It was also a good opportunity for her parents to come see their new home and learn the way.

Hearing they would be eating at home, Jing Shiyun subconsciously furrowed her brow.

’An occasion this formal should be at a restaurant or hotel. Eating at home just isn’t proper.’

Just then, Jiang Li finished eating, wiped her mouth, and walked out into the garden with her phone. "Even though it’s at home, it’s not a bit inferior to a hotel."

Noticing the change in background, Jing Shiyun asked suspiciously, "Is this your new home?"

"Yes," Jiang Li said, adjusting the camera. "This is the garden. Pretty, isn’t it?"

Jing Shiyun nodded in satisfaction. "It certainly is nice."

There isn’t a woman alive who doesn’t like flowers, no matter her age.

Seeing the brilliant clusters of blossoms made her spirit soar.

After panning the camera around, Jiang Li belatedly said, "I’m free right now, so let me give you a tour of our new home."

Jing Shiyun had originally thought it would only take a few minutes, but an hour later, they weren’t even halfway through the tour.

The video call only ended because Zhong Mufeng called Jiang Li. Otherwise, the tour probably would have taken another hour or two, or even longer.

The moment the call connected, Zhong Mufeng’s frantic voice came through. "Babe, are you free right now?"

Jiang Li put the call on speaker and set her phone aside. "If you need something, just say it."

"I desperately need your help right now!"

"The model we booked had to cancel at the last minute, so you’re the only one who can save me."

Jiang Li had been about to go back to bed for a nap, but at these words, she immediately turned around and changed into a different outfit. "You should be glad I’m not working right now. Otherwise, I’d really be willing but unable to help."

Zhong Mufeng grinned. "That’s why I applied for the highest hourly rate for you: 1,000 yuan an hour."

Jiang Li teased, "Wow! As expected of Director Zhong, you really go all out."

Zhong Mufeng ignored Jiang Li’s teasing. "Just get over here, quick! It’s a code red emergency!"

"Coming, coming, stop rushing me," Jiang Li said, grabbing her bag and heading out the door.

After hanging up, she sent a message to Xie Wan, telling her to wait in the underground parking garage.

Zhong Mufeng called twice more to hurry them along. To make up time, Xie Wan floored it, pushing the car to 180 as she sped toward the venue, arriving in about twenty minutes.

When they arrived, Zhong Mufeng had no time for pleasantries. She grabbed Jiang Li, pulled her toward the dressing room, and told an assistant to help her change while she went back out to manage things.

Jiang Li was like a Barbie doll, waiting for others to dress her up.

Once her clothes were changed and her makeup was done, the assistant spoke into her headset, "Sister Qing, she’s ready."

Zhong Mufeng’s frayed nerves finally relaxed. "Okay, just make sure she comes out at the right time."

Looking at herself in the mirror, a flash of astonishment crossed Jiang Li’s eyes.

’No wonder they say clothes make the man.’

’Change your clothes, put on some makeup, and you’re a total goddess.’

’Even she was falling in love with herself.’

She wore a pale yellow ball gown with a strapless, backless design that revealed her elegant collarbones. A flowing sash tied at her waist added a playful touch, and a circlet of dried flowers in her hair made her look like a sprite who had wandered out of a deep forest.
